Peer reviewedMovshovitz-Hadar, Nitsa; And Others – Journal for Research in Mathematics Education, 1987
A content-oriented analysis of written solutions to test items in Israeli high school graduation examinations in mathematics yielded six error categories: misused data; misinterpreted language; logically invalid inference; distorted theorem or definition; unverified solution; and technical error.
